O que é Beta.io? Entenda sua importância no mundo da tecnologia e inovação
No mundo da tecnologia, plataformas de desenvolvimento e testes de aplicativos se tornam cada vez mais essenciais. Uma das ferramentas que tem ganhado destaque é o Beta.io. Esta plataforma é focada em fornecer um ambiente para o teste beta de aplicativos, permitindo que os desenvolvedores compartilhem suas criações com um público limitado para coletar feedbacks antes do lançamento oficial. Neste artigo, exploraremos de forma detalhada o que é o Beta.io, como ele funciona e sua importância no processo de desenvolvimento de software.
O que é o Beta.io?
Beta.io é uma plataforma voltada para a gestão de testes beta de aplicativos móveis e software. Ela permite que empresas e desenvolvedores lancem versões preliminares de seus aplicativos para um grupo selecionado de usuários, antes de disponibilizar o produto final para o público em geral. O objetivo principal de realizar testes beta é coletar feedbacks, identificar erros, otimizar a experiência do usuário e fazer ajustes necessários antes de um lançamento definitivo.
Esse tipo de teste é crucial no ciclo de desenvolvimento de software, pois oferece uma visão realista de como o aplicativo ou sistema se comporta em condições reais de uso. Os desenvolvedores podem usar as informações coletadas durante o período de testes beta para corrigir falhas, melhorar a usabilidade e, em última análise, entregar um produto mais robusto e confiável.
Como o Beta.io Funciona?
O funcionamento do Beta.io é simples e intuitivo. A plataforma oferece uma série de recursos que tornam o processo de distribuição de versões beta de aplicativos mais eficiente. Aqui está um passo a passo de como o Beta.io pode ser utilizado:
1. Criação do Projeto: O primeiro passo é criar um projeto na plataforma. Isso envolve configurar o aplicativo ou software que será testado, fornecer informações básicas sobre o produto e carregar os arquivos de instalação necessários, como APKs para Android ou arquivos IPA para iOS.
2. Seleção de Testadores: Uma vez que o aplicativo está pronto para ser testado, o desenvolvedor pode selecionar um grupo de testadores. O Beta.io permite que você escolha testadores com base em características específicas, como localização geográfica, tipo de dispositivo e outras preferências. Isso permite que o teste seja direcionado a um público mais relevante.
3. Distribuição da Versão Beta: Após selecionar os testadores, o Beta.io facilita a distribuição do aplicativo. O teste pode ser realizado por meio de links de download exclusivos, que podem ser enviados diretamente aos testadores ou acessados via convites personalizados.
4. Coleta de Feedbacks: Durante o teste, os testadores podem fornecer feedbacks sobre o aplicativo, destacando bugs, problemas de usabilidade ou qualquer outra falha observada. O Beta.io oferece uma interface fácil para os testadores registrarem suas impressões, além de permitir que os desenvolvedores acompanhem esses feedbacks em tempo real.
5. Análise e Aperfeiçoamento: Com base no feedback dos testadores, os desenvolvedores podem fazer os ajustes necessários no aplicativo. Esse processo é iterativo e pode envolver várias rodadas de testes beta antes de o aplicativo ser considerado pronto para o lançamento público.
Benefícios do Uso do Beta.io
O Beta.io oferece uma série de vantagens tanto para os desenvolvedores quanto para os testadores. Aqui estão alguns dos principais benefícios de usar essa plataforma:
– Feedback Qualificado: Testadores beta geralmente são mais críticos e detalhistas, o que significa que os feedbacks recebidos são de alta qualidade e podem ajudar a identificar problemas que talvez não fossem percebidos por uma equipe interna de QA (Quality Assurance).
– Aprimoramento do Produto: Com base nos feedbacks e erros reportados durante o teste beta, os desenvolvedores podem melhorar o aplicativo significativamente antes do lançamento, aumentando as chances de sucesso do produto final.
– Maior Engajamento do Usuário: Ao envolver usuários reais no processo de desenvolvimento, os desenvolvedores criam uma base de fãs antes mesmo do lançamento. Testadores beta muitas vezes se tornam defensores do produto e ajudam a promover o aplicativo quando ele for oficialmente lançado.
– Economia de Tempo e Dinheiro: Identificar bugs e problemas de usabilidade durante a fase beta ajuda a evitar que esses problemas se tornem mais caros de corrigir após o lançamento. Isso economiza tempo e recursos a longo prazo.
Casos de Uso do Beta.io
O Beta.io pode ser utilizado para diversos tipos de produtos e serviços. Embora seja especialmente popular entre os desenvolvedores de aplicativos móveis, a plataforma também pode ser aplicada a outras áreas da tecnologia, como:
– Aplicativos Móveis: É o uso mais comum da plataforma, onde desenvolvedores de aplicativos para Android e iOS testam suas versões beta antes do lançamento oficial.
– Software de Desktop: Desenvolvedores de software para sistemas como Windows, macOS ou Linux podem usar o Beta.io para testar suas versões beta com um público selecionado, garantindo que o produto final seja estável.
– Jogos: No setor de jogos, o Beta.io é amplamente utilizado para testar versões alfa e beta de jogos antes de seu lançamento comercial. Os feedbacks coletados ajudam os desenvolvedores a ajustar a jogabilidade e corrigir erros que podem impactar a experiência do usuário.
– SaaS (Software como Serviço): Plataformas SaaS também se beneficiam do Beta.io, permitindo que novos recursos ou versões sejam testados por um grupo específico de usuários antes de serem disponibilizados para todos os clientes.
Como o Beta.io se Destaca da Concorrência?
Embora existam várias ferramentas e plataformas disponíveis para testes beta, o Beta.io se destaca por suas funcionalidades específicas e seu foco na simplicidade e eficiência. Algumas das características que fazem do Beta.io uma plataforma única incluem:
– Interface Intuitiva: A plataforma é fácil de usar, permitindo que desenvolvedores iniciantes e experientes possam gerenciar seus testes beta com eficiência, sem a necessidade de complexos processos ou configurações.
– Segurança: O Beta.io oferece recursos de segurança para garantir que os aplicativos beta sejam distribuídos apenas para os testadores autorizados. Isso é especialmente importante para proteger informações confidenciais durante a fase de testes.
– Suporte Multiplataforma: O Beta.io oferece suporte para diversas plataformas, incluindo Android, iOS e até mesmo desktop, tornando-o uma solução versátil para uma variedade de desenvolvedores.
– Análise Avançada de Feedbacks: A plataforma também fornece ferramentas analíticas que ajudam os desenvolvedores a interpretar os feedbacks de maneira estruturada e eficiente, permitindo a priorização de correções e melhorias.
Conclusão
O Beta.io é uma ferramenta poderosa e essencial para desenvolvedores que buscam melhorar a qualidade de seus aplicativos antes do lançamento oficial. Com seus recursos focados na coleta de feedback de usuários reais, distribuição de versões beta de maneira simples e eficaz, e suporte a uma variedade de plataformas, o Beta.io tem se consolidado como uma solução de destaque no mercado de testes de software. Se você é um desenvolvedor em busca de maneiras de aprimorar seus produtos antes de lançá-los, o Beta.io é uma opção altamente recomendada para garantir a qualidade e o sucesso do seu lançamento.